I still like my speculation even though it is almost certainly not the Minear direction: the race is a war game to settle disputes. Decisions are made not only on who wins or who loses (though the sponsor of the winner gets major benefits) but what the order is - all the way down to who is last. So the racers are not chosen just for their probability of winning, but for their strengths and weaknesses corresponding to their sponsor in a real war/corporate power grab/mob war. It will be interesting to see how many eps it takes something comes along that disproves it.
What is clear is that there is a cabal, that each team has sponsors, and that someone - either those running the race, or those sponsors or both manipulate and interfere with the racers - that it does not stop with luring or forcing people into the race.
Unless whoever is running it is stupid, there is betting going on, but I'll be disappointed if gambling is all that is behind the race. There should be some bigger motive, hopefully dark grey - basically evil but where some of those participating behind the scenes can kid themselves that the end justifies the means.
